Interdisciplinary full mouth rehabilitation of a patient with amelogenesis imperfecta from childhood to young adult-hood: A 12-year case report

Clin Case Rep. 2024 Mar 21;12(3):e8704. doi: 10.1002/ccr3.8704. eCollection 2024 Mar.

Abstract

Treatment of patients with amelogenesis imperfecta extends over many years, from childhood to early adulthood. Their management at any age is complex and has to be adapted in relation to therapies validated in the general population.
